JRE 7 update 45

Hi,
After updating jre 7update 45 my applet is not working.The applet is signed with the trusted certificate.
Also accrding to release notes I have added the attributes
Permissions : all-permissions
codebase : *
Application-Name : Display
Application-Library-Allowable-Codebase : *
Caller-Allowable-Codebase : *
After adding the attribute I again siged the jar file using the same trusted certificate we have been using.
Still it gives some blue shield warning message.
Is there a bug in jre 7update 45.Or I am missing something because of which it is not working.
Is there any solution for suppressing these security warnings.

This is resolved and jar file is working fine without any warning message.
What I did is.I added the below attrributes to my jar file
Codebase : *
Permissions: all-permissions
Application-Allowable-Library-Codebase : *
Caller-Allowable-Codebase : *
I added these attributes by extracting the jar file contents through winzip.
After this I signed the jar file again with new trusted certificate anded used the following cermgr Command
to include the certificate in ROOT and trusted publisher
certmgr.exe -add  <path of the certificate> -s -r localMachine ROOT
certmgr.exe -add <path of the cetificate> -s -r localMachine trustedpublisher
This made my jar file working fine with jre 7 update 45.

  • JRE update after sysprep fails

    Hi,
    During our rollout of windows 7, we are having problems with JRE 7. We can install and update without any problems before sysprep. But after sysprep when a user tries to update it fails with "installation Interrupted". We setup logging the install and found MSI error 1603, with a reference to CustomAction InstallJava. As show in the log here:
    MSI (s) (0C:04) [09:55:16:706]: Set LastUsedSource to: C:\Users\USERNAME\AppData\LocalLow\Sun\Java\jre1.7.0_45\.
    MSI (s) (0C:04) [09:55:16:706]: Set LastUsedType to: n.
    MSI (s) (0C:04) [09:55:16:706]: Set LastUsedIndex to: 1.
    MSI (s) (0C:04) [09:55:16:706]: Executing op: ActionStart(Name=InstallJava,Description=Registering Java Runtime Environment,)
    Action 09:55:16: InstallJava. Registering Java Runtime Environment
    MSI (s) (0C:04) [09:55:16:706]: Executing op: CustomActionSchedule(Action=InstallJava,ActionType=3073,Source=BinaryData,Target=MSIInstallJRE,)
    MSI (s) (0C:F8) [09:55:16:722]: Invoking remote custom action. DLL: C:\Windows\Installer\MSI31AC.tmp, Entrypoint: MSIInstallJRE
    MSI (s) (0C:78) [09:55:16:722]: Generating random cookie.
    MSI (s) (0C:78) [09:55:16:738]: Created Custom Action Server with PID 2180 (0x884).
    MSI (s) (0C:58) [09:55:16:987]: Running as a service.
    MSI (s) (0C:58) [09:55:16:987]: Hello, I'm your 32bit Elevated custom action server.
    CustomAction InstallJava returned actual error code 1603 (note this may not be 100% accurate if translation happened inside sandbox)
    Action ended 09:55:52: InstallFinalize. Return value 3.
    Any1 have any experience with a situation like this?

    We found the issue!
    Apparently our Symantec Endpoint Protection, anti-virus program, had a definition setting called:
    "Prevent registration of new Browser Helper Objects (HIPS) [AC15]" that was causing the issue.
    We disabled this and the problem completely disappeared.
